Tekmar Group secures £2.0m Middle East subsea infrastructure contract

Tekmar Group

Tekmar Group plc (LON:TGP), a leading provider of asset protection technology and offshore energy services globally, has announced the award of a contract to supply bespoke subsea infrastructure technology for a pipeline project via a major offshore EPC contractor operating in the Middle East.

The base case scope is valued at approximately £2.0m, the full amount of which will be recognised in the current financial year. This covers the design and manufacture of specialist reinforced concrete support structures for a large-diameter gas pipeline. There is also potential for additional scope supporting the broader requirements of the project. Delivery is scheduled to be completed by September 2025.
